Ukraine’s use of blockchain in documenting Russian war crimes

Ukraine has already taken commendable strides in utilizing blockchain technology to document Russian war crimes. By partnering with Dokaz, a groundbreaking solution developed by Starling Lab, Ukrainian prosecutors can securely store and access digital records related to war crimes. This innovative use of blockchain not only facilitates the prosecution of guilty parties but also ensures the integrity and safety of crucial evidence.

Project Development and Support

The development of Dokaz by Starling Lab has received substantial support from organizations committed to the decentralized web. The FTX Foundation and the Filecoin Foundation for the Decentralized Web have played an instrumental role in providing financial backing and expertise to help expedite the implementation of Dokaz. Similar efforts are underway in Puerto Rico

Ukraine is not alone in its pursuit of utilizing distributed ledgers for improved accountability and transparency. Puerto Rico’s lawmakers have also been exploring the potential of blockchain technology to combat corruption within their jurisdiction. However, recent corruption charges against a former governor have cast uncertainty over the progress of Puerto Rico’s blockchain initiatives.
